Employment Taxes.

No one likes paying taxes or dealing with the IRS, but operating a business without some tax awareness is like standing in front of a fast moving train. The outcome is certain and will end in disaster.

Employers are required to deduct and withhold a specified percentage of their employee's wages and then pay that amount to the IRS. This money is held in trust by the employer for the Federal Government. The IRS considers employment taxes as the Government's money, not your money, not the employee's money, but money belonging to the United States Treasury. The IRS takes this very seriously and is extremely strict with regard to the payment of employment taxes and the collection of outstanding employment tax obligations.

If your business is struggling and hits a rough patch, you may be tempted to just not file employment tax returns until you have the money to pay the tax. This is a big mistake. You will have to pay not only the tax but also large penalties for not filing the return on time, not making federal tax deposits, not paying the tax and interest.

In addition to penalties and interest, you or anyone who has the authority to sign checks can be held personally liable for all taxes not paid to the IRS. You may want to review the section on Trust Fund Recovery Penalty on this web site.

Few creditors have the collection power of the IRS. Few creditors can shut your business down and collect their money faster than the IRS.
